## Sensor drift: what to do at 3am

If the GrowLoop controller starts reporting humidity swings that don't match the backup probes in the Fernwick greenhouse, it's almost always sensor drift, not an actual climate event. Don't panic and don't touch the vents manually. First, restart the calibration daemon and give it ten minutes to re-baseline. If readings still disagree by more than 5%, flip the controller into safe mode. The safe-mode thresholds it will use are these.

config for yahap-bajof:
[istix]
host = istix.qorvelsys.internal
user = istix_svc
database = istix_prod

Handover — Pagecrest public API pagination

Dena, before you take over: we switched the Pagecrest REST API from offset pagination to opaque cursors last sprint. Clients on v1 still send offsets, so the shim translates them, but it caps at 10,000 rows and logs a deprecation warning. If the cursor cache evicts early, list endpoints return duplicates — that's the main alert you'll see. The shim and cache behaviour are controlled entirely by the values below.

deployment values, yadug-bawif:
[framir]
team = pelox
access_code = ac_a38ab2
owner = tamion.julael
host = framir.tolvaqlabs.test
port = 11211
peer = tammir.zemvargrid.local
salt = 2215ef03
pin = 1541

Finance Review Summary — Divestiture of Kestrane Unit

For the board of Mirelle Holdings. The sale of the Kestrane packaging unit closed at terms consistent with the approved range. Net proceeds will retire the Arbor facility debt; remainder funds working capital. Transition services run six months. One-time charges land in Q4; recurring margin improves thereafter. Audit sign-off expected shortly. The confidential note on forward plans appears immediately below.

internal memo for yajef-tajeg: The renewal with Ralaelek Group closes at $2 million a year, 15 percent above the last contract. Project Zorix slips by two quarters because of the tooling delay.

Hey — quick handover before I'm out next week. Per-tenant rate quotas in Marchwell are mostly done: the quota ledger is live, enforcement is on for the pilot tenants, and overrides go through the admin console. Two loose ends: the burst allowance math rounds oddly for tiny tenants, and the nightly reconciliation job hasn't been load-tested. Neither should block the release, but flag them in the notes. While I'm away, the person picking this up and owning sign-off is below.

approver of yawig-yajef = Briius Jorix